What Is Workers’ Compensation?
Workers’ compensation insurance benefits are available to employees who are injured or become ill due to a work-related incident. If one of your employees is injured on the job and medically authorized to take time off from work, they will be reimbursed for lost wages and the medical expenses related to treatment and rehabilitation.
How Much Is Workers Compensation Insurance?
Insurance companies set workers compensation premiums using information about your business, your industry, job classifications and your claims history. Get a personalized quote from your agent to understand how much you’ll pay for workers compensation insurance.
How Does Workers Compensation Insurance Work?
If one of your covered employees becomes ill or is injured in a work-related incident or accident, workers compensation insurance may pay a portion of their lost wages as well as any medical expenses they incur due to the incident. Workers’ compensation is no-fault coverage, which means that even if your employee is to blame for the injury or illness, they still have coverage.
What Does Workers’ Compensation Insurance Cover?
Workers’ compensation has four main benefits that are typically provided, including:
- Wage loss benefits
- Medical benefits
- Death/dependent benefits
- Vocational rehab benefits

Why is Workers’ Compensation Important?
Workers’ compensation serves two primary purposes: to help injured or ill workers receive medical care and income compensation and to help protect employers against lawsuits by workers. Regardless of who’s at fault in a work incident, workers’ compensation typically helps benefit at least one party. To prevent significant financial loss, your business must have workers’ compensation insurance. What’s more, California requires most employers to carry workers’ compensation.
